چکیده

Creation artificial fractures are a widely used method for stimulation of the wells to increase the oil and gas production. In hydraulic fracturing the cracks are expanded from the wellbore to the producing formation. This technology has been used worldwide and now also is in deployment. The proper use of this stimulation method can improve the reservoir rock permeability. Therefore this method can play an effective role in improving the productivity index of oil and gas wells.In this study, hydraulic fracturing has been compositionally simulated in a heavy oil reservoir in southwest of Iran. The goal of this paper is evaluating the productivity of different oil layers after performing the hydraulic fracturing. Hence the different layers of studied reservoir have been selected for hydraulic fracturing propagation. Then the layers which have had the greatest cumulative oil production were recognized as candidate layers for hydraulic fracturing treatment.
